DAHLER Invest strengthens investment business in Hanover

DAHLER Invest is expanding its activities in the investment property sector in Hanover under the leadership of Insa Sophia Cornelius and Jörn Fischer, aiming to develop the nationwide investment business.

DAHLER Invest is intensifying its commitment to the investment property segment in Hanover. This expansion is being managed by experienced licensees and managing directors Insa Sophia Cornelius and Jörn Fischer. They have been running the DAHLER locations Hanover City and Hanover North since 2003, making them among the company's first partners.

Jörn Fischer contributes his expertise from brokering residential and commercial buildings to the structure. With the expansion to include DAHLER Invest, this specific know-how is now being specifically integrated into the supra-regional investment strategy. The focus is on multi-family houses and properties with mixed-use residential and commercial units.

Hanover, the state capital of Lower Saxony, is characterised by a comparatively price-stable real estate market. Due to extensive destruction during the Second World War, the supply of classic old buildings is limited. The market is primarily characterised by modernised older multi-family houses and new builds. For larger investment properties, institutional and semi-professional investors dominate the demand side.

Insa Sophia Cornelius, Head of DAHLER Invest Hanover, notes that Hanover is an established and price-stable investment location. After significant price increases between 2015 and 2018 and a subsequent correction, a sideways movement is currently being observed. She highlights that modernised multi-family houses, where purchase price, rental yield and property quality are in a balanced relationship, are of particular interest to investors. The long-standing local presence makes it possible to combine this experience with the nationwide DAHLER investment network.

The professional backgrounds of Cornelius and Fischer complement their joint real estate business. Ms Cornelius began her career as a real estate agent in Mallorca, then worked in Hamburg and completed further training as a real estate specialist alongside her job. Mr Fischer studied business administration and computer science, worked as a management consultant, and also ran his own boatyard for the manufacture and repair of sports rowing boats.

Jörn Fischer, also Head of DAHLER Invest Hanover, explains that the investment market in Hanover is significantly shaped by long-term oriented market participants. In an environment where purchase prices have stabilised after a correction, a precise analysis of the respective property and its yield prospects is becoming more important. The combination of local market knowledge and access to DAHLER Invest's supra-regional network makes it possible to connect both owners and prospective buyers beyond the local market.

Price developments in Hanover have shown different phases in recent years. After an initial phase with catch-up potential compared to other major German cities, significant price increases occurred between 2015 and 2018. After the coronavirus pandemic, purchase prices recorded a decline. Currently, Cornelius and Fischer observe a sideways movement, which means that, in addition to location, the quality and modernisation status of the property, as well as sustainably achievable rental yields, are increasingly coming into focus for investors.
